re = /@([a-z]|-|[0-9])+\/([a-z]|-|[0-9])+/m
str = 'Lorem Ipsum i-s simply @dummy/text of the printing and typesetting industry. Lorem Ipsum has been the industry\'s @nAme/iNValid text ever since @the/1500s, when an @unknown//printer took a @galley of type and scrambled it to make a type specimen book. It has survived not only five centuries, but also/the leap @into/electronic typesetting, remaining essentially unchanged. It was popularised in the 1960s with the release of Letraset sheets/containing Lorem Ipsum passages, and more recently with desktop publishing software like Aldus PageMaker including versions of Lorem Ipsum'
# Print the match result
str.scan(re) do |match|
puts match.to_s
end
Please keep in mind that these code samples are automatically generated and are not guaranteed to work. If you find any syntax errors, feel free to submit a bug report. For a full regex reference for Ruby, please visit: http://ruby-doc.org/core-2.2.0/Regexp.html